WebAug 19, 2024 · A general partner is liable personally for all of the debts and obligations of the business. 3. DEBTS AND CORPORATIONS “Shareholders” are a corporation’s owners. Corporations limit shareholder liability so that in most cases, creditors may collect debts only by pursuing the assets of the corporation.
